BioAge Labs, Inc. Faces Securities Lawsuit: What Does This Mean for Investors and the World?
On February 22, 2025, Bleichmar Fonti & Auld LLP, a prominent securities law firm, announced that they have commenced an investigation into potential securities law violations by BioAge Labs, Inc. (BIOA) and certain of its senior executives. This announcement came after a lawsuit was filed against the company in the United States District Court for the Southern District of New York.
